Let There Be Light

For drivers everywhere safety is of utmost importance. That is why vehicles are mounted with tools fashioned in a way as to provide nocturnal visibility under various driving circumstances. This is where the car lighting system, consisting of fog lights, head lights, conspicuity devices and signaling devices, enters the scene. These gears provide extra illumination helping improve nighttime driving safety.

In a year, imagine 7 deaths and 88 injuries occurring due to insufficient vehicle lighting. Visibility is an essential aspect in driving. It would be difficult for anyone to maneuver an automobile with Mother Nature providing fog, snow or storm. Then again, too bright a light could prove just as dangerous because the glare it produces tends to blind other drivers.

Manufacturers offer custom head lights that allow vehicle owners to add a little touch of personality by furnishing halogen beams or xenon lightsyet still giving the assurance that their products will not create a condition where other road users will be temporarily deprived of sight.

It’s the responsibility of the owner to make sure the vehicle lights are kept clean and in good condition at all times. Regular check-up needs to be done to assure that all car lights function well. You may choose to check your car lights before leaving the parking lot or during gas-up stops for the reason that you may not become aware of faulty lights when you’re already cruising the road. From head lights to signal lights to fog lights, all of these should be operational. If a car light does not work, most probably it is due to a busted bulb. In such event, the bulb could easily be replaced with a new one. A visit to your local auto parts will solve the problem. These bulbs are standard pieces so they are not hard to find. Most headlight bulbs are secured with spring clips. Be gentle when removing the clips so that it will not bend out of place. Take note that some bulbs must not be touched using bare hands like the halogen bulbs and the parking light. A simple contact could trigger a chemical reaction, which may damage the bulb or the reflector. For DIY aficionados, I suggest that you check your owner’s manual for directions and specifications on how to properly install the bulbs.

Another reason for car lights not working would be corroded wirings and/or loose connections. These wire connections may be tricky, if you are not confident with the wiring you’ve done, you could always opt to ask the help of a qualified service professional.

I recommend that when you change your car lights do it in pairs---meaning if you change the left head light that lost its spark, change the right one too. More or less the life span of the right head light will soon come to a stop.

Regular headlights must be change after a year of usage but there are companies that provide products that last longer and illuminates much brighter than the standard bulbs like the xenon lights or the halogen bulbs.

Be it regular or xenon lights, make certain that it will serve its purpose---visibility.
